Cal. Code Regs. tit. 16, § 1304
For purposes of Section 2216.2 of the code, “adequate security” means that a physician has coverage of the type prescribed in Section 2216.2 of the code in the amount of not less than one million dollars per incident and not less than three million dollars per year. The division shall reevaluate the requirements in this regulation at least every three years.
Note: Authority cited: Sections 2018 and 2216.2, Business and Professions Code. Reference: Section 2216.2, Business and Professions Code.
1. New section filed 12-5-2000; operative 1-4-2001 (Register 2000, No. 49). For prior history see Register 95, No. 3.
